Output 52babc913399dd670dc870aaf81db75b26f763f98c12004eb66f1d47beebd3de:0

value
3061078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55c23881c3e433062768e861e3e327e4f4a890f OP_EQUAL
address
3JDxcBSWUcdH2KZPokfvdLPR1b55PigExg
transaction
52babc913399dd670dc870aaf81db75b26f763f98c12004eb66f1d47beebd3de
spent
true